July 16, 2019, marks the 50th anniversary of the Apollo 11 mission launch, which culminated 4 days later (July 20, 1969) with Neil Armstrong becoming the first person to walk on the moon. This commemorative Saturn V rocket (limited production) is a 1:200 scale model, fully assembled and virtually ready to fly out of the box. With many details and markings included for exceptional realism, the rocket can be displayed with the stand provided, or commemorate "one small step for man, one giant leap for mankind" with a launch. Model also comes with a mail-in card to request a free limited-edition, 10 x 30" poster.
